Montgomery County, Ohio operates as a public policy office focused on serving local residents through a team-driven approach anchored in values such as innovation, inclusion, collaboration, stewardship, and professionalism. The organization emphasizes investing in people, the economy, and essential services to support safe, healthy, and productive lives for the community. Based in Dayton, Ohio, the public institution positions itself as an employer offering benefits, competitive pay, opportunities for advancement, and a chance for employees to contribute to community well-being, while maintaining an equal employment opportunity stance. In addition to core public service functions, recent activity in its broader public policy context includes partnerships and initiatives related to housing, behavioral health infrastructure, and collaborations with community organizations to support shelter and crisis services. The entity falls within the public policy and government services landscape, operating as a state and local government body dedicated to delivering programs and services to residents through its public sector mission.
